@charset "utf-8"; body,div,hr,blockquote,ul,ol,li,table,th,td,dl,dt,dd,h1,h2,h3,h4,h5,h6,pre,form,input,button,select,textarea,fieldset,legend{margin:0;padding:0} body{font-size:12px;color:#666666; background-color:#f0f0f0;font-family:Tahoma,Geneva,sans-serif,'宋体';} h1,h2,h3,h4,h5,h6{font-size:100%;font-weight:normal} .clearfix{*zoom:1} .clearfix:after{display:block;clear:both;content:".";visibility:hidden;height:0} *+html img{-ms-interpolation-mode:bicubic} .clearboth{ clear:both;} ul,ol{list-style:none} fieldset,img{border:0} address,cite,dfn,em,var{font-style:normal} strong,.fcu{font-weight:bold} table{border-collapse:collapse;border-spacing:0} button,.fhand{cursor:pointer} button,input,select,textarea{font-size:100%;} html{zoom:expression(function(ele){ele.style.zoom="1";document.execCommand("BackgroundImageCache",false,true)}(this))} .clear {padding:0px 0px 0px 0px; margin:0px; clear:both;} .clear1 {padding:5px 0px 5px 0px; clear:both; margin:0px;} .clear2{ height:145px; clear:both; margin:0px;} .fl{ float:left;} .fr{ float:right;} .ml20{ margin-left:20px;} .mb15{ margin-bottom:15px;} /* ----- Links ----- */ a {text-decoration:none;color:#666;} a:hover {color:#2f9def; text-decoration:none;} /***header***/ #header{ width:100%; height:85px; background:url(../images/home/zytbg.jpg) repeat-x;} #header .top{ width:1002px; height:85px; margin:0 auto;} #header .top .logo{ float:left;} #header .nav{ float:left;} #header .nav li{ width:110px; height:85px; line-height:85px; margin-left:20px; float:left;} #header .nav li.li1 a{ display:block; width:60px; height:85px; background:url(../images/home/icon.png) left center no-repeat; background-position:20px; padding-left:50px; font-family:"微软雅黑"; font-size:18px; color:#fff;} #header .nav li.li2 a{ display:block; width:60px; height:85px; background:url(../images/home/icon1.png) left center no-repeat; background-position:20px; padding-left:50px; font-family:"微软雅黑"; font-size:18px; color:#fff;} #header .nav li.li1 a:hover{ display:block; width:60px; height:85px; background:#e10082 url(../images/home/icon.png) left center no-repeat; background-position:20px; padding-left:50px;} #header .nav li.li2 a:hover{ display:block; width:60px; height:85px; background:#e10082 url(../images/home/icon1.png) left center no-repeat; background-position:20px; padding-left:50px;} #header .search{ width:214px; height:30px; float:left; margin-top:30px; margin-left:20px;} #header .hyinfo{ height:63px; float:left; margin-left:10px; margin-top:10px; position:relative;} #header .hyinfo li{ display:block; width:60px; height:63px; line-height:55px; float:left; padding-right:20px;} #header .hyinfo li.hy2 a{ display:block; color:#fff; font-weight:bold; text-align:center;} #header .hyinfo li.hy1 { display:block; width:60px; background:url(../images/home/icon2.jpg) right center no-repeat;} #header .hyinfo li img{ display:block; width:55px; height:55px; -moz-border-radius:50px; -webkit-border-radius:50px; border:4px solid #7e8188; float:left;} #header .hyinfo li.aon {background:url(../images/home/icon2.jpg) right center no-repeat; _background:url(../images/home/icon2.jpg) right center no-repeat;} .subbox{ position:absolute; top:63px; left:0px; width:175px; display:none; margin:0px; padding:0px;} .subbox span{ display:block; width:135px; height:7px; background:url(../images/home/icon2.png) left top no-repeat; background-position:20px;} .subbox a{ display:block; background:#fff; line-height:35px; text-align:left; color:#000; padding-left:15px;} .subbox a:hover{ color:#e60085;} /***banner***/ .banner{ width:100%; height:360px; text-align:center; overflow:hidden;} .school{ width:1002px; margin:0 auto; display:block; position:relative;} .school span{ height:25px; line-height:25px; position:absolute; bottom:15px; right:10px;} .school span a{ color:#fff;} .school span a:hover{ color:#e60085;} /***container***/ #container{ width:1002px; margin:15px auto; display:block; overflow:hidden;} .left749{ width:749px; display:block; overflow:hidden; float:left; border:1px solid #dcdcdc; background:#fff;} .classlist{ width:749px; display:block; overflow:hidden;} .classlist li{ margin:30px 15px 0px; width:719px; height:152px; border-bottom:1px solid #e9e9e9; position:relative;} .classlist li .classimg{ width:225px; height:124px; float:left;} .classlist li .classinfo{ width:480px; height:124px; float:right; margin-left:14px;} .classlist li .classinfo .classname a{ display:block; font-size:14px; color:#666666; font-weight:bold; line-height:30px;} .classlist li .classinfo .schoolname a{ display:block; font-size:12px; color:#e10082; line-height:35px;} .classlist li .classinfo .teacher a{ display:block; font-size:12px; color:#666666; line-height:35px;} .classlist li .classinfo .visit a{ display:block; font-size:12px; color:#ff5a00; line-height:35px;} .right235{ width:235px; display:block; overflow:hidden; float:right; border:1px solid #dcdcdc; background:#fff;} .tjlist li{ width:201px; height:230px; padding:15px 14px 0px; border-bottom:1px solid #e9e9e9;} .tjlist li .tjimg{ width:201px; height:113px;} .tjlist li h2{ font-size:14px; font-weight:bold; color:#707070; line-height:30px;} .tjlist li h3{ line-height:20px;} .classlist1{ width:709px; display:block; overflow:hidden;} .classlist1 li{ margin:30px 15px 0px; width:679px; height:152px; border-bottom:1px solid #e9e9e9; position:relative;} .classlist1 li .classimg{ width:225px; height:124px; float:left;} .classlist1 li .classinfo{ width:440px; height:124px; float:right; margin-left:14px;} .classlist1 li .classinfo .classname a{ display:block; font-size:14px; color:#666666; font-weight:bold; line-height:30px;} .classlist1 li .classinfo .schoolname a{ display:block; font-size:12px; color:#3baae1; line-height:35px;} .classlist1 li .classinfo .teacher a{ display:block; font-size:12px; color:#666666; line-height:35px;} .classlist1 li .classinfo .visit a{ display:block; font-size:12px; color:#ff5a00; line-height:35px;} .right235{ width:235px; display:block; overflow:hidden; float:right; border:1px solid #dcdcdc; background:#fff;} .tjlist li{ width:201px; height:230px; padding:15px 14px 0px; border-bottom:1px solid #e9e9e9;} .tjlist li .tjimg{ width:201px; height:113px;} .tjlist li h2{ font-size:14px; font-weight:bold; color:#707070; line-height:30px;} .tjlist li h3{ line-height:20px;} /**font***/ .f_red{ color:#ea0023;} .f_blue{ color:#3daee7;} .f_black{ color:#929192;} /***ad***/ .ad{ width:1190px; margin:0 auto;} /***form***/ .input{ width:180px; height:30px; border-right:0 none; background:url(../images/home/sbg.jpg) no-repeat; border:0px; padding-left:6px; line-height:30px; font-family:"微软雅黑"; font-size:14px; color:#555555; float:left;} .input2{ position:absolute; right:0px; bottom:30px;} .btn{ width:28px; height:30px; float:left;} /***footer***/ #footer{ width:100%; height:337px; background:#e6e6e6; margin-top:20px; padding-top:20px;} .links{ width:1190px; height:145px; margin:0 auto; padding-top:15px; background:#fff;} .linkpic{ width:1135px; height:49px; line-height:49px; margin:0px auto; overflow:hidden;} .linkpic h1{ width:118px; height:49px; background:#0296e3; color:#fff; font-size:18px; font-weight:normal; text-align:center; float:left; font-family:"微软雅黑";} .picshow{ width:1017px; height:49px; float:left;} .linktext{ width:1135px; height:40px; margin:35px auto 0px;} .linktext h1{ width:70px; height:40px; font-size:14px; color:#6c6c6c; float:left; font-family:"微软雅黑";} .textlink{ width:1065px; height:40px; float:left;} .textlink a{ padding:0px 3px; line-height:20px; font-size:12px;} .copyright{ width:1190px; margin:25px auto 0px;} .Navigation{ text-align:center; line-height:20px;} .Navigation a{ color:#666666; padding:0px 5px;} .Navigation a:hover{ text-decoration:underline; color:#3daee7;} .copy{ text-align:center; line-height:30px; color:#666666;} /***title**/ .title{ height:85px; line-height:85px; float:left;} .title h1{ font-family:"微软雅黑"; font-size:34px; color:#ffffff;} .title1{ height:45px; line-height:45px; font-family:"微软雅黑"; border-bottom:1px solid #e9e9e9;} .title1 h1{ width:135px; height:45px; line-height:45px; text-align:center; font-size:16px; color:#707070; float:left; border-right:1px solid #dcdcdc;} .title1 h1.hover{ border-top:2px solid #e10082; color:#e10082;} .title2{ height:40px; background:#f3f3f3; border-bottom:1px solid #e9e9e9;} .title2 h1{ padding-left:10px; color:#707070; font-family:"微软雅黑"; font-size:16px; line-height:40px;} .title3 h1{ font-family:"微软雅黑"; font-size:16px; color:#0a90e8; line-height:35px; padding-left:20px;} .title4{ height:45px; border-bottom:1px solid #e3e3e3;} .title4 h1{ width:116px; height:45px; line-height:45px; background:url(../images/home/kct.jpg) bottom no-repeat; font-family:"微软雅黑"; font-size:16px; color:#fff; margin-left:15px; text-align:center; font-weight:bold;} .title5{ height:45px; border-bottom:1px solid #e3e3e3; background:#f4f4f4;} .title5 h1{ width:116px; height:45px; line-height:45px; font-family:"微软雅黑"; font-size:16px; color:#555555; margin-left:15px; text-align:center; font-weight:bold;} .title6{ height:45px; line-height:45px; font-family:"微软雅黑"; padding-left:15px;} .title7{ height:40px; background:#fff; border-bottom:1px solid #e9e9e9;} .title7 h1{ padding-left:10px; color:#18a1f5; font-family:"微软雅黑"; font-size:16px; line-height:40px;} .title8{ height:40px; background:#fff; border-bottom:1px solid #e9e9e9; border-top: 3px solid #3baae1;} .title8 h1{ padding-left:10px; color:#18a1f5; font-family:"微软雅黑"; font-size:16px; line-height:40px;} /* ----- page ----- */ .page{ text-align:center; clear:both; padding:30px 0px 30px 0px; color:#2b2b2b; height:22px; line-height:20px; color:#989898;} .page .prev{ display:inline-block; text-align:left; vertical-align:middle; background:url(../images/bg_page.gif) 0px top no-repeat; padding-left:22px; width:48px; height:22px; color:#bdbdbd;} .page .next{ text-align:left; display:inline-block; vertical-align:middle; margin:0px 6px; background:url(../images/bg_page.gif) 0px center no-repeat; padding-left:12px; width:58px; height:22px; color:#bdbdbd;} .page .num a{ display:inline-block; vertical-align:middle; color:#656565; background:url(../images/bg_page.gif) 0px bottom no-repeat; text-align:center; margin-left:4px; width:28px; height:22px;} .page .num a:hover,.page .num a.on{ background:url(../images/bg_page.gif) -28px bottom no-repeat; font-weight:bold; color:#fff; text-decoration:none;} .page em{ color:#000000; font-family:Arial, Helvetica, sans-serif; margin-right:16px;} .page .inputpage{ width:24px; height:17px; line-height:17px; border:1px solid #a9aaac;} .page .btngo{ width:25px; height:20px; color:#686868; background-image:url(../images/btn_go.gif); border:0px; cursor:pointer;} /***课程介绍**/ .kcjs{ width:1000px; display:block; overflow:hidden; border:1px solid #e3e3e3; background:#fff;} .left750{ width:750px; float:left; border-right:1px solid #e3e3e3;} .dxlogo{ width:295px; height:75px; margin:15px;} .dxinfo{ width:700px; padding:25px;} .dxinfo h1{ font-size:16px; color:#555555; line-height:30px; font-weight:bold;} .dxinfo p{ font-size:14px; color:#666666; line-height:25px;} .right250{ width:245px; float:right;} .list{ width:205px; margin:20px;} .list li{ width:205px; height:74px; margin-bottom:20px;} .list .lsimg{ width:80px; height:74px; padding:3px; border:1px solid #e3e3e3; float:left;} .list .lsjj{ width:110px; height:74px; float:right;} .list .lsname{ width:110px; height:20px; font-size:14px; color:#666666; font-weight:bold;} .list .lszc{ width:110px; height:20px; font-size:14px; color:#666666; margin-top:10px;} .kcms{ width:1002px; display:block; overflow:hidden; margin-top:15px;} .left248{ width:248px; display:block; background:#fff; overflow:hidden; float:left;} .menu{ width:246px; display:block; border:1px solid #e3e3e3; border-bottom:0px; background:#fff;} .menu li{ width:246px; height:53px; line-height:53px; border-bottom:1px solid #e3e3e3; } .menu li span{ float:right; color:#666666; padding-right:20px;} .menu li span.on{ float:right; color:#fff; padding-right:20px;} .menu li a{ display:block; line-height:53px; font-size:14px; color:#666666; padding-left:30px;} .menu li a:hover,.menu li a.on{ background:#21a3f3; color:#fff; font-weight:bold;} .right735{ width:735px; border:1px solid #e3e3e3; background:#fff; display:block; float:right;} .content_news{ font-size:14px; line-height:30px; padding:17px 30px 20px 30px;} .content_news p{ text-indent:2em;} .zxsc{ width:730px; overflow:hidden;} .myvideo{ width:200px; height:158px; float:left; margin:15px 20px 15px; border:1px solid #e5e5e5;} .myvideo1{ width:200px; height:158px; float:left; margin:15px 15px 0px;} .myvideoimg{ width:200px; height:118px; position:relative;} .myvideoimg img{ width:200px; height:118px;} .myvideoimg h3{ width:193px; height:27px; line-height:27px; padding-left:7px; background:url(../images/timebg.png) repeat; position:absolute; bottom:0px; left:0;} .myvideoimg h3 a{ font-size:12px; color:#fff; font-weight:bold;} .myvideoimg h3 a:hover{ text-decoration:underline;} .play1{ width:27px; height:19px; position:absolute; right:8px; bottom:5px;} .play1 a{ display:block; width:27px; height:19px; background:url(../images/play1.png) no-repeat; text-indent:-9999px;} .time{ display:block; position:absolute; background:url(../images/timebg.png) repeat-x; width:45px; height:20px; text-align:center; color:#fff; right:0px; bottom:32px;} .lsjs{ width:1000px; display:block; overflow:hidden; border:1px solid #e3e3e3; background:#fff;} .list1{ width:980px; margin:10px;} .list1 li{ width:490px; height:135px; margin-bottom:20px;} .list1 .lsimg{ width:145px; height:135px; padding:3px; border:1px solid #e3e3e3; float:left;} .list1 .lsjj{ width:315px; height:135px; float:right;} .list1 .lsname{ width:315px; height:20px; font-size:14px; color:#666666; font-weight:bold; margin-top:30px;} .list1 .lszc{ width:315px; height:20px; font-size:14px; color:#666666; margin-top:10px;} .list1 .lsdx{ width:315px; height:20px; font-size:14px; color:#666666; margin-top:10px;} .left735{ width:735px; border:1px solid #e3e3e3; background:#fff; display:block; float:left;} .right248{ width:248px; display:block; background:#fff; overflow:hidden; float:right;} .list2 li{ width:248px; height:208px; border-bottom:1px solid #e3e3e3; margin-top:20px;} .list2 .kcimg{ width:206px; height:115px; margin:0px 16px;} .list2 .kcname{ width:206px; height:25px; line-height:25px; margin:0px 16px;} .list2 .kcname a{color:#666666; font-size:14px;} .list2 .kccc{ width:206px; height:25px; line-height:25px; margin:0px 16px;} .list2 .kccc a{color:#3baae1; font-size:12px;} .list2 .author{ width:206px; height:25px; line-height:25px; margin:0px 16px;} .list2 .author a{color:#666666; font-size:12px;} .qbclass{ width:1000px; display:block; overflow:hidden; background:#fff; border:1px solid #e3e3e3; margin-top:15px;} .list3 li{ height:198px; border:1px solid #e3e3e3; margin-top:20px; float:left; margin-left:15px;} .list3 .kcimg{ width:220px; height:122px; padding:3px;} .list3 .kcname{ padding-left:15px; height:25px; line-height:25px;} .list3 .kcname a{color:#666666; font-size:14px; font-weight:bold;} .list3 .author{ padding-left:15px; height:25px; line-height:25px;} .list3 .author a{color:#666666; font-size:12px;} .qbschool{ width:1000px; display:block; overflow:hidden; background:#ffffff;} .list4 li{ width:233px; height:138px; float:left; margin-top:15px; margin-left:15px; background:url(../images/home/simg.jpg) no-repeat;} .list_news{ margin:16px 12px 0px 12px;} .con_news{ color:#BFB5AD; line-height:26px; margin:30px 0px 10px 0px; height:130px; border-bottom:1px solid #E5E5E5;} .con_news dt{ float:left; width:118px; padding:5px; height:78px;text-align:center; border:1px solid #D1D1D1;} .con_news dd{ float:right;width:520px; text-align:left; color:#8B8B8B} .f_yellow{ font-size:12px; color:#ff6000; padding-left:10px;} .con_news dd p{ margin:0;} .con_news dd a{ font-size:12px; font-weight:bold; padding-top:6px;color:#444444;}